Professor Min Ae Lee-Kirsch is Professor of Molecular Pediatrics at the University Hospital Carl Gustav Carus, Technische Universität Dresden, and a clinical geneticist specializing in rare immune-mediated diseases. Her research focuses on the genetic and molecular mechanisms of autoinflammatory and autoimmune disorders, particularly type I interferonopathies and dysregulation of innate immune sensing.
She has made seminal contributions to understanding how defects in nucleic acid metabolism trigger autoimmunity. Her work established that mutations in the DNA exonuclease TREX1 cause systemic lupus erythematosus, providing key evidence linking impaired clearance of endogenous nucleic acids to chronic immune activation. More recently, her group identified disease-causing variants in UNC93B1 that disrupt TLR7-mediated RNA sensing, leading to early-onset systemic autoimmunity.
By integrating human genetics with molecular immunology, her research has advanced the understanding of nucleic acid–driven immune responses and their role in disease, opening new avenues for targeted therapies.
